Publicis Worldwide Launches New Global Digital Arm : Publicis Modem
Publicis Modem and Publicis Dialog Under Single Leadership to Create Global Digital and Marketing Services Powerhouse for the Ne

By: PR Newswire
May. 3, 2007 04:50 PM

PARIS, May 3 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Effective immediately, Modem Media becomes Publicis Modem, the new global digital arm of Publicis Worldwide. The move signifies the critical role digital will play throughout the Publicis network around the world, with Publicis Modem at the forefront. Martin Reidy, formerly President, Modem Media, will lead this effort as Chief Executive Officer of the new Publicis Modem. Martin Reidy will also assume the role of CEO of Publicis Dialog, a top digital and marketing services agency with offices in over forty countries. Martin Reidy will report to Richard Pinder, Chief Operating Officer, Publicis, and will sit on the Worldwide Executive Committee of the network.

Publicis Modem will expand internationally by aligning with Publicis Dialog operations and offices in the US & Canada, Europe, Middle East, Asia, Latin America and Australia. Mr. Reidy will oversee one cohesive leadership team for Publicis Modem and Publicis Dialog, which is one of the leading global networks in interactive, CRM, and promotions. Details on the new organization will be defined over the next few weeks.

Together Publicis Modem and Publicis Dialog will have over 2,000 employees worldwide, and will form a global powerhouse of digital expertise. Modem Media has been mainly based in San Francisco and Norwalk (Connecticut), in the US, and London in the UK, and the Modem Media headquarters in San Francisco will immediately become Publicis Modem's global headquarters. Publicis Modem in London retains the high profile global HP relationship. Other London clients move to Digitas as that agency establishes a UK presence.

Olivier Fleurot, Executive Chairman of Publicis, said: "This move will help us to create more innovative solutions for our clients. The demand for on-line services is growing rapidly and this move confirms our commitment to strengthening our capabilities in the digital world. We are very happy to welcome our Modem Media colleagues into the Publicis family."

Richard Pinder, COO, Publicis, said: "When Olivier and I arrived, we made the digital future of our industry a top priority. This is a major step towards that future. In bringing Modem's skills to bear on Dialog, we will be both expanding geographically as well as increasing our range of service capabilities. The combination of Publicis Dialog and Publicis Modem will deeply increase our holistic strengths."

Martin Reidy, new CEO of Publicis Modem and Publicis Dialog, concluded, "The fit with Modem and the Publicis family has already been very powerful. By aligning ourselves directly with the Publicis network we can create an even greater impact for our clients. More than ever above-the line and below-the line marketing efforts must be developed as a combined strategy. Publicis Modem has the reach, scope and depth to set a new standard in integrated, global, digital initiatives. Paired with Publicis Dialog, we can additionally lead our clients in innovative CRM and promotions. We have a vision for Modem and this takes the agency and our capabilities to the next level very, very quickly."

Colin Hearn, currently worldwide CEO Publicis Dialog, will be leaving the company. Richard Pinder recognized the contribution Mr. Hearn made, stating, "We would like to thank Colin for more than three years of hard work in expanding the geographic reach of Dialog as well as building on the quality of the offering."

About Publicis Modem

Publicis Modem is a digital and direct marketing agency that works with world-class companies across the globe in more than 40 countries, with 250 employees. Publicis Modem offers a range of integrated marketing services, including strategy and planning; award winning creative design and execution; media research, planning and buying; search marketing; online and offline direct marketing; and technology enablement. Publicis Modem is part of the network Publicis and a member of the Paris-based Publicis Groupe .

About Publicis Dialog

Publicis Dialog is a Marketing Services network with over 2,000 employees in 43 offices in 36 countries. Publicis Dialog is part of Publicis, the network, the largest one in Europe. The core disciplines of Publicis Dialog include CRM, Direct Marketing, Digital/Interactive, and Sales Promotion. Publicis Dialog handles many blue chip clients globally, regionally and locally, including: Beam Global Spirits and Wine Inc., Hewlett Packard, Renault, McDonalds, Coca Cola, Nestle, Sony Playstation, L'Oreal, Virgin Atlantic. For more details see the website: http://www.publicis-dialog.com/

About Publicis Worldwide

As the founding pillar of Publicis Groupe, Publicis is the largest network within our organization. With over 9,100 employees in 251 offices across 82 countries, Publicis is the largest network in Europe and the sixth largest in the world. Its unique approach: La Holistique Difference. This entails having a large palette of skills and expertise to address all of a client's communication needs. French by origin, European by essence, Publicis prides itself on its unmatched understanding of multicultural challenges. Key clients are: Nestle, L'Oreal, HP, Renault, Sanofi-Aventis, UBS, P&G and more. Website: http://www.publicis.com/
